Output 63ba42ad9c2f34a160405edf01e8cb5d8905963430abb1da66419fda6ac87945:0

value
961234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7043e6d942fb2a82c138a88317d73dfb05be623 OP_EQUAL
address
3JNifWxHWZnECa14CthnndSHV2zobRk3Xc
transaction
63ba42ad9c2f34a160405edf01e8cb5d8905963430abb1da66419fda6ac87945
confirmations
330252
spent
true